[发明专利]数据处理方法、装置和电子设备在审
申请号: | 202110353537.6 | 申请日: | 2021-03-31 |
公开(公告)号: | CN115145998A | 公开(公告)日: | 2022-10-04 |
发明(设计)人: | 杨稼晟;姚国涛 | 申请(专利权)人: | 北京金山云网络技术有限公司 |
主分类号: | G06F16/27 | 分类号: | G06F16/27;G06F16/25;G06F16/182 |
代理公司: | 北京超凡宏宇专利代理事务所(特殊普通合伙) 11463 | 代理人: | 荣颖佳 |
地址: | 100000 北京市海淀*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 数据处理 方法 装置 电子设备 | ||
1.一种数据处理方法,其特征在于,所述方法应用于运行有对象存储引擎bluestore的数据访问接口的设备,所述数据访问接口预先挂载在所述设备的目标存储区域;所述数据访问接口用于导出所述目标存储区域中的数据文件,以及所述数据文件的存储结构;所述方法包括:
接收针对所述目标存储区域的数据访问请求;
调用所述数据访问接口,导出所述目标存储区域中的数据文件,以及所述数据文件的存储结构。
2.根据权利要求1所述的方法,其特征在于,所述数据访问接口与内核中的虚拟文件系统连接;
所述调用所述数据访问接口,导出所述目标存储区域中的数据文件,以及所述数据文件的存储结构的步骤包括:
通过所述虚拟文件系统调用所述数据访问接口,导出所述目标存储区域中的数据文件,以及所述数据文件的存储结构。
3.根据权利要求2所述的方法,其特征在于,预设C标准库中设置有读函数接口,所述读函数接口与所述虚拟文件系统连接;
所述通过所述虚拟文件系统调用所述数据访问接口的步骤,包括:
调用所述读函数接口与所述虚拟文件系统进行通信,以通过所述虚拟文件系统调用所述数据访问接口。
4.根据权利要求3所述的方法,其特征在于,所述读函数接口与至少一个应用程序连接;所述导出所述目标存储区域中的数据文件,以及所述数据文件的存储结构的步骤包括:
通过所述虚拟文件系统调用所述读函数接口,将所述数据文件,以及所述数据文件的存储结构发送至指定应用程序;
通过所述指定应用程序显示所述数据文件,以及所述数据文件的存储结构。
5.根据权利要求1所述的方法,其特征在于,所述方法还包括:
如果接收到针对所述目标存储区域的数据更新请求,更新所述目标存储区域中的数据文件,和/或数据文件的存储结构。
6.根据权利要求1所述的方法,其特征在于,接收针对所述目标存储区域的数据访问请求的步骤之前,所述方法还包括:
将所述数据访问接口的名称,以及所述目标存储区域的大小保存至所述目标存储区域;
将所述数据访问接口挂载至所述目标存储区域。
7.一种数据处理装置,其特征在于,所述装置设置于运行有对象存储引擎bluestore的数据访问接口的设备,所述数据访问接口预先挂载在所述设备的目标存储区域;所述数据访问接口用于导出所述目标存储区域中的数据文件,以及所述数据文件的存储结构;所述装置包括:
接收模块,用于接收针对所述目标存储区域的数据访问请求;
导出模块,用于调用所述数据访问接口,导出所述目标存储区域中的数据文件,以及所述数据文件的存储结构。
8.根据权利要求7所述的装置,其特征在于,所述数据访问接口与内核中的虚拟文件系统连接;所述导出模块还用于:
通过所述虚拟文件系统调用所述数据访问接口,导出所述目标存储区域中的数据文件,以及所述数据文件的存储结构。
9.一种电子设备,其特征在于,包括处理器和存储器,所述存储器存储有能够被所述处理器执行的机器可执行指令,所述处理器执行所述机器可执行指令以实现权利要求1-6任一项所述的数据处理方法。
10.一种机器可读存储介质,其特征在于,该机器可读存储介质存储有机器可执行指令,该机器可执行指令在被处理器调用和执行时,机器可执行指令促使处理器实现权利要求1-6任一项所述的数据处理方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京金山云网络技术有限公司,未经北京金山云网络技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110353537.6/1.html,转载请声明来源钻瓜专利网。